Consider a DVC Membership

One of the best ways to save money on your Disney vacation is by becoming a member of the Disney Vacation Club (DVC). This membership allows you to purchase points that can be used towards accommodations at Disney resorts, and it also offers other benefits such as discounted tickets and dining options.

While there is an initial cost to join the DVC, it can save you money in the long run if you plan on visiting Disney frequently. You can also get DVC resales to reduce your cost in acquiring DVC membership. Additionally, if you decide the membership is not for you, there are options to sell your DVC membership or even rent out your points.

Plan and Be Flexible

Another key to a budget-friendly Disney vacation is planning and being flexible with your travel dates. The cost of accommodations, flights, and tickets can vary depending on the time of year you plan to visit. Try to avoid peak season and opt for less popular times to save money. Also, be flexible with your travel dates and consider booking mid-week instead of weekends.

Pack Your Snacks and Drinks

Food and beverages at Disney parks can quickly add up, especially if you have a family to feed. To save money, pack your snacks and drinks to bring into the parks. Not only will this save you money, but it also allows for healthier options and can accommodate any dietary restrictions.

Take Advantage of Free Activities

Disney offers plenty of free activities that are just as magical as the paid ones. Take a stroll through Disney Springs, watch fireworks from outside the parks, or catch a parade from a nearby location. You can also explore the different resorts and see their unique theming and decor for free. These activities are not only budget-friendly but can also add some extra magic to your vacation.

Prioritize Your Must-Do Experiences

With so many amazing attractions and experiences at Disney, it can be tempting to try and do it all. However, this can quickly add up and strain your budget. Instead, make a list of your must-do experiences and prioritize them. This will help you focus on what’s most important to you and your family, without overspending.
